PegBio Signs R&D Collaboration with SN BioScience to Pair Three Innovative Peptide Candidates with SNA Long‑Acting Delivery for Metabolic Diseases

PegBio Co., Ltd. (HKG: 2565) announced that it has entered into a material transfer agreement (MTA) with South Korean biotechnology company SN BioScience, Inc. to conduct joint R&D collaboration on three independently developed innovative peptide drug candidates for metabolic diseases. The collaboration will apply SN BioScience’s proprietary Serinol Nucleic Acids (SNA) long‑acting drug delivery platform to PegBio’s candidates — including APGP6 — evaluating whether next‑generation delivery technology can sharpen differentiation in an increasingly competitive metabolic space.

Collaboration Profile & Strategic Logic

  • PegBio’s Contribution: Three independently developed innovative peptide candidates targeting metabolic diseases, including lead program APGP6
  • SN BioScience’s Contribution: The proprietary SNA long‑acting drug delivery platform, designed to extend duration of action for therapeutic molecules
  • Joint Evaluation: The parties will assess in vivo performance, pharmacokinetics, and development potential of each candidate‑platform combination
  • Differentiation Thesis: Combining long‑acting delivery technologies with different molecules aims to enhance product differentiation in metabolic disease therapy, where dosing frequency is a key competitive lever
